
"Steve Cooper guided Swansea City to back-to-back play-off finishes, restoring direction during financial constraints, but left by mutual consent after a poor second season."
"At Nottingham Forest, Cooper transformed a struggling side into a cohesive unit, leading them to a dramatic play-off run and promotion via a Wembley victory in 2022."
"Despite initial success in the Premier League, Cooper faced challenges with squad turnover and a poor run of results, ultimately leading to his dismissal after one win in 13 matches."
"His brief tenure at Leicester City ended with three wins in 15 games, impacting his reputation in English football as he faced another sacking."
